首页
AI Coding
NEW
沸点
课程
直播
活动
AI刷题
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
会员
登录
注册
Java微服务架构
啾啾学习日记
创建于2025-01-15
订阅专栏
关于Java微服务架构设计
等 1 人订阅
共6篇文章
创建于2025-01-15
订阅专栏
默认顺序
默认顺序
最早发布
最新发布
异步通信P2—Kafka与消息
Kafka与消息是怎么交互的?怎么发消息?怎么存消息?怎么消费消息?消息怎么防重?怎么快速处理?等等……
异步通信P1—消息队列基本概念
我们继续来了解服务通信的异步方式——消息队列(Message Queue,MQ)。 这种方式通常应用于异步处理、流量削峰\缓冲、数据广播、事件分发、最终一致性保障等场景,追求高性能、应用解耦。
[Java微服务架构]7_事务处理
事务贯穿于各类信息系统之中,是数据库、分布式共享数据等技术不可或缺的组成部分。 只要系统涉及信息的存储、处理或数据的管理,事务机制就扮演着关键角色,通过其特性确保数据操作的可靠性和一致性。
[Java微服务架构]5_服务通信之异常处理
本篇主要讨论服务集群故障时的处理方案设计。 故障情况一:集群整个不可用,此时需要考虑整体架构的容错性,情况二:部分服务不可用,这种情况健康服务实例的流量激增需要控制。
[Java微服务架构]4_服务通信之客户端负载均衡
在上一篇服务通信 中我们已经了解到服务同步通信的选择,本篇继续探索服务通信的设计思想。 负载均衡 为设计算法获取信息 数据采集方式 设计流量分发算法 轮询 最小连接数 动态权重算法
[Java微服务架构]3_服务通信
服务通信的最后过程 —— 通信本身的简单概述。简单讲述了服务通信的同步通信方式REST与gRPC,并简单介绍了RPC是什么,gRPC为什么快。